Here is a breakdown of all the eggs taken out of me:
Total 19 eggs

  • 5 eggs not mature enough
  • 14 eggs injected with sperm (ICSI)
    • 3 eggs not fertilized
    • 11 eggs fertilized
      • 1 embryo not viable on day 5
      • 2 embyros transferred back (my little embies)
      • 8 embryos on observation until day 6
        • 6 embryos not viable on day 6
        • 2 embryos frozen
